Apple is set to launch new MacBook Air models powered by the M5 chip in spring 2026. Analyst Mark Gurman from Bloomberg has reported this exciting news. Alongside the MacBook Air, Apple is also developing M5 Pro and M5 Max versions of the MacBook Pro, expected to debut early next year.

There won’t be any major design changes for these new models. Instead, Apple focuses on enhancing performance through chip upgrades. A more significant design refresh for the MacBook Pro is anticipated in late 2026 or early 2027. This update will be important, marking the first major redesign since 2021.

The new MacBook Air, which received an update in 2022, includes a larger 15-inch model introduced in 2023. Future updates for the Air may include an upgraded display by 2027.

Apple is also working on new versions of the Mac Studio and Mac mini, likely featuring the M5 Pro and M5 Max chips as well. Additionally, two new external displays are in development, with at least one being a second-generation Studio Display. However, there’s no timeline yet for when these updates will be available.
